Kristen Wolff is a Clinical Assistant Professor of Law at the University of Michigan Law School, where she works in the Zell Entrepreneurship Clinic. She supports inventors and entrepreneurs through her clinical teaching and practice. Wolff has a strong engineering background and a career focused on intellectual property strategy for startups.
Education:
- University of Michigan, BSE, biomedical engineering, magna cum laude
- University of Michigan, MSE, biomedical engineering
- Duke University, JD
Her research interests include Intellectual Property and Antitrust, Corporate and Securities Law, Law and Technology, and Public Interest Law. She practiced as an intellectual property attorney in California at firms like Knobbe Martens and Foley & Lardner, advising early-stage startups. She later co-founded the Aurora Consulting Group to provide part-time in-house patent counsel services and worked at the University of Michigan Office of Technology Transfer. She also guest lectures at the University of Michigan College of Engineering.
At Michigan Law, she teaches courses such as Entrepreneurship Clinic Seminar, Advanced Clinical Law, and Zell Entrepreneurship Clinic Mini-Seminar.
